GrowthDeFi is a decentralized ecosystem that focuses on capital efficiency and maximizing returns through a variety of products.

The goal is to maximize tokenholder value and maintain the best yields and products in the market**.**

The ecosystem is composed of three tokens:

GRO:

GRO is the core token of the ecosystem, it has governance rights over everything, it is deflationary through multiple mechanisms and it gets a share of the revenue from anything that is built.

GRO can be staked for more GRO (stkGRO) or for BNB (GRO Yield).

WHEAT:

WHEAT is the token used to incentivize the products of the GrowthDeFi ecosystem. In exchange, a large portion of the revenues are directed towards buybacking and burning it, the ultimate goal is to make WHEAT deflationary.

gROOT:

gROOT is a diversified way to invest into GrowthDeFi products such as strategy tokens, PMTs and more…

gROOT can be staked in gROOT Harvest for BNB.

The short term and long term goals of WHEAT:

Throughout the earliest launch period the emissions of WHEAT are used to incentivize users to deposit their LP tokens into the protocol, the purpose of this is to quickly accumulate large balances in the Fee Collector contracts that constantly buyback and burn WHEAT.

The longer term goal for WHEAT is having emissions of it to continually incentivize the different products offered whilst being deflationary, deflation in WHEAT happens when the buyback contract is buybacking and burning more WHEAT than the emission rate at the time.

WHEAT’s unique sustainable model:

The typical farming uses up any existing revenues to automatically buyback the token, however the point in time where the protocol is making the most revenue is usually also the point at which the token price is the highest, this makes the effective buyback amount negligible compared to the tokens being issued.

When the price of the token eventually crashes down so does the TVL/volume of the protocol and as a direct consequence the revenue of it, the result is that no matter the current state of the protocol it never has enough revenue to buyback more than what it’s issuing.

This is where WHEAT innovates:

WHEAT’s main revenue source comes from deposit and performance fees, the deposit fee builds up the balances of the fee collector contracts very quickly and the user is less likely to withdraw their funds if there is a deposit fee.

The performance fee capitalizes on the higher likelihood of TVL staying within the protocol and generates a more consistent revenue source.

Deposits Fees (Big & Inconsistent)

Performance Fees (Very reliable)

In the case of PancakeSwap strategies this fees are paid in LP tokens, they go to the fee collector contract which in turns harvests CAKE regularly and uses it to buyback WHEAT & GRO.

As a result of this setup the amount of WHEAT being bought back is dependent on the profits generated by all the fee collector contracts, not the direct revenue of the protocol.

This leaves three scenarios depending on what the price of WHEAT does:

Scenario 1 (WHEAT’s price goes down)

Consequences:

-Less Deposit & Performance Fees (Note that even if it’s less it’s still constantly increasing since the LP tokens aren’t used for buybacks, only the CAKE it farms).

-Swap fee growth remains the same

-Amount of WHEAT being bought back up increases inversely to the price drop, example: If all the CAKE being collected is buybacking 3,000 WHEAT/day and the price drops 90% then Buybacks are 10 times more effective and it’d now be buybacking 30,000 WHEAT/day , this is why it is important to have an uncorrelated buyback source to the price.

Scenario 2 (WHEAT’s price stays flat)

Consequences:

-Consistent growth from Deposit & Performance Fees

-Swap Fee growth remains the same

-Amount of WHEAT being bought back up increases overtime as a result of the increase in the balance through deposit/performance fees and the swap fee growth.

Scenario 3 (WHEAT’s price increases)

Consequences:

-Substantial increase in Deposits & Performance Fees

-Swap Fee growth remains the same

-Amount of WHEAT being bought back up goes down but its buybacking power increases faster than in the other scenarios, making it better prepared for when the price stays flat (Scenario 2) or starts dropping (Scenario 1).

The goal of WHEAT is sustainable farming, growth over the long term and being able to incentivize the products of the Growth DeFi ecosystem.

GRO Tokenomics

GRO Tokenomics:

GRO is the core token of the ecosystem, it has governance rights over everything, it is deflationary through multiple mechanisms and it gets a share of revenue from anything that is built.

GRO can be staked for more GRO (stkGRO) or for BNB (GRO Yield).

Contract address:

ETH: 0x09e64c2b61a5f1690ee6fbed9baf5d6990f8dfd0

BSC: 0x336ed56d8615271b38ecee6f4786b55d0ee91b96

Supply Distribution as of 06/04/2021:

Circulating supply of 342,286 GRO

Total supply of 580,977 GRO

Deflationary Mechanisms for GRO:

-GRO Bridge (1.5% of every swap is burnt)

-stkGRO (5% of every stake/unstake is burnt)

-GRO Yield (3% of every deposit/withdrawal is burnt)

-WHEAT Buyback Contract (15% of the revenue this contract gets is used to buyback and burn GRO)

Long-Term goals for GRO

1-Decreasing even further the circulating and the total supply through deflationary mechanisms and additional treasury burns.

2-Increasing the utility and profit-sharing capabilities of GRO through contracts such as stkGRO and GRO Yield.

3-Increasing the revenue sources from which GRO benefits.
